Hotel Tarahumara 3.11

3.7 star(s) from 7 votes
Cuauhtémoc, 31500
Mexico

About Hotel Tarahumara

Hotel Tarahumara Hotel Tarahumara is a well known place listed as Lodging in Cuauhtémoc ,

Contact Details & Working Hours